The genuine Mitsubishi one is expensive. There is one made by Gates that is much cheaper if you want to go non-genuine.
Apparently, Repco carry the Gates belt. Some posting somewhere had the part number listed as T987.
Me, I get the Mitsy one, as I thrash the nuts off that engine quite frequently.
Make sure your mechanic knows how to properly remove and refit that belt. Take a read of Mark A's bad experience:
